TymeBank has partnered with Khona La Local Stores to empower local businesses in Daveyton, Ekurhuleni with an affordable solution that makes it easy for customers to make cashless payments. TymeBank’s point-of-sale solution, TymePOS, is an app that turns any NFC-enabled cell phone into a tap-and-go payment device for debit and credit card payments.
Khona La is a chain of independently owned township based spaza shops, operating under the same brand name, which aims to transform the township and rural retail market by creating eco-systems that benefit store owners (Network Partners) and the communities they serve.
